Le rôle du chef de projet dans le processus de développement de site Web

Publié: 2022-08-21

Lorsque les entreprises réalisent qu'elles ont besoin d'une forte présence numérique, elles engagent des développeurs Web pour la créer. Dans le processus de développement Web, il existe un rôle important qui s'intègre comme la pièce manquante du puzzle : le chef de projet.

Si vous choisissez une société de développement Web plutôt qu'un freelance, les services d'un chef de projet vous seront très probablement proposés. Cela est particulièrement courant avec des équipes de développement dédiées qui travaillent uniquement sur votre projet pendant une longue période. Cependant, il n'y a souvent pas de compréhension commune parmi les nouveaux clients quant à la raison pour laquelle ils ont besoin d'un PM.

Nous avons décidé d'apporter un éclairage sur ce sujet et d'aborder le rôle du chef de projet dans le développement web.

Que fait un chef de projet web ?

Un chef de projet est la personne de l'équipe de développement Web qui contrôle le processus, coordonne les actions des membres de l'équipe et assure la livraison du projet dans les délais.

Voici quelques éléments dont un PM est responsable :

  • assurer une communication fluide entre le client et les développeurs
  • hiérarchiser les exigences et les tâches du projet
  • allouer les ressources
  • estimer le temps
  • rendre compte des progrès
  • suivi des heures de travail
  • créer une atmosphère favorable dans l'équipe
  • s'assurer que les attentes du client sont satisfaites
  • s'assurer que les délais sont respectés
  • s'assurer que les budgets sont respectés
  • dépannage de divers problèmes
  • aider au développement, aux tests et au déploiement si nécessaire
  • maintenir la documentation
  • faire des décisions
  • gérer les risques
  • et beaucoup plus

Quelles sont les qualités d'un bon chef de projet ?

Un bon chef de projet doit posséder de grandes compétences en gestion d'entreprise, en leadership, en communication, en résolution de problèmes et en planification. Si l'équipe est originaire d'un pays où l'anglais n'est pas une langue maternelle, un PM doit le parler très bien de toute façon afin de faire passer le message du client à l'équipe et de s'assurer que chaque tâche est correctement effectuée.

Un chef de projet doit également être une personne férue de technologie qui comprend les tenants et les aboutissants du projet de développement Web. Si vous travaillez avec un chef de projet qui correspond à cette description, vous n'aurez pas à vous soucier de votre projet de développement Web.

Pourquoi avez-vous besoin d'un chef de projet pour le développement web

Certains clients nient l'importance d'un chef de projet dans la recherche d'économies sur les heures de travail. Résumons quelques raisons pour lesquelles travailler avec un chef de projet en développement web est extrêmement bénéfique :

  • Vous avez la personne en charge de votre projet qui s'occupe de sa bonne mise en œuvre ainsi que de toutes les questions d'organisation.
  • Les développeurs ne passent pas leurs heures sur la routine administrative, ce qui augmente le temps dont ils disposent pour des décisions créatives et un travail efficace.
  • Il est également rentable de ne pas facturer aux développeurs les heures qu'ils consacrent à des tâches non liées au développement.
  • Il y a toujours une personne qui peut résoudre un problème sur le projet, tandis que vous pouvez garder votre calme et continuer vos affaires.
  • Un PM connaît les forces et les faiblesses de chaque membre de l'équipe, ce qui est utile pour la répartition optimale des tâches, ainsi que pour motiver parfaitement tout le monde.

Le rôle du chef de projet à chaque étape du développement d'un site Web

Un chef de projet doit être impliqué tout au long du cycle de développement web. Examinons de plus près à quoi un chef de projet peut être utile à chaque étape du développement de votre site Web.

  • Négociation

C'est à ce stade qu'une agence de développement Web découvre vos besoins et vos attentes concernant le projet de développement Web et vous fournit une estimation approximative du temps et des coûts. À ce stade, un PM étudie vos objectifs, votre budget et vos délais, et vous recommande le modèle de coopération le plus viable (forfait, temps et matériel, etc.). Un PM propose également des idées sur les meilleures solutions technologiques et la meilleure fonctionnalité. pour votre cas. Enfin, cette personne participe à façonner votre future équipe de développement web.

  • Découverte

Au stade de la découverte du développement Web, une équipe crée une feuille de route pour le projet, façonne l'architecture et l'UX du site Web et vous donne une estimation plus détaillée. Le backlog du projet, ou une liste des fonctionnalités nécessaires, est développé selon la méthodologie Scrum. Bien sûr, un PM a beaucoup de travail à faire au stade de la découverte - planifier les tâches, diviser le temps de développement en sprints (périodes encadrées, généralement de deux semaines, pour effectuer une partie spécifique du projet), et plus . Les plans, les graphiques, les calendriers et les horaires sont les meilleurs amis d'un PM ici.

  • Développement

Lorsque tout est enfin prêt, les développeurs peuvent commencer leur travail par itérations selon le plan, et le PM est pleinement engagé dans le processus de supervision. Un chef de projet répartit les tâches, organise les réunions d'équipe, gère les routines quotidiennes, suit les progrès, traite tous les problèmes à venir, supprime tous les obstacles au bon déroulement du processus de développement, recueille les commentaires réguliers du client, et bien plus encore. Un PM s'assure que le concept du client est bien compris pour chaque tâche et que les contraintes de temps et de budget du projet sont pleinement respectées.

  • Libérer

Enfin, le moment est venu de mettre votre site Web en ligne afin que tous les utilisateurs puissent le voir sur le Web. Votre chef de projet prépare ce moment à toutes les étapes. Un PM doit s'assurer que tout est prêt à la date nécessaire et contrôler le bon déploiement. Votre chef de projet est alors prêt à vous rendre compte de tous les détails du produit terminé.

  • Entretien supplémentaire

Une fois le produit Web mis en ligne, il peut encore nécessiter de bons soins afin qu'il reste toujours à jour, fonctionne correctement et protégé contre les dernières menaces. C'est pourquoi de nombreux clients optent pour un entretien supplémentaire.

Un PM peut gérer un projet de maintenance comme un projet de développement web. La communication, l'attribution des tâches, le contrôle de la mise en œuvre et bien plus encore dépendent du PM. Un chef de projet surveille également le site et avertit le client lorsqu'une mise à jour de sécurité doit être appliquée.

Embaucher une équipe avec un chef de projet professionnel

Comme vous pouvez le voir, le rôle d'un chef de projet dans le développement de sites Web est énorme - en fait, il détermine en grande partie le succès de votre produit. Chez WishDesk, vous pouvez embaucher une équipe de développement Web qui comprendra un PM professionnel avec toutes les compétences nécessaires. Écrivez-nous et laissez votre projet bien guidé commencer!